Dear executive team and branch managers,

Following careful review of demand studies and site surveys, we will proceed with entry into Merrowfield beginning next spring. Two branches are planned for Lowbridge and Carn Aster, with staffing drawn partly from existing teams who volunteer for transfer. Branch managers should identify candidates and prepare local inventory impact notes by quarter-end. Fit-out budgets will be confirmed separately. The broader commercial rationale behind this move is summarised below.

internal memo for faweg-tafog: Only 7 of the 100 pilot accounts renewed Quenael, so a churn review is set for April 15.

Intern cohort (Briarhall programme) arrives Tuesday, 08:45. Reception: sign each intern in, issue a grey lanyard, and direct them to Room 1B. No unescorted access above floor one. Collect lanyards at 17:30 daily during week one. Their mentor, Saul Petric, handles questions. Admit the group through the east turnstile using the code below.

door code, bagef-yafop: bdg-ZFZML-07646

FareForge shipping-fee rules engine: CI fails intermittently on the zone-matrix job. Cause: stale rule snapshots cached between runs. Fix: clear the snapshot cache, retrigger. Support should not escalate unless three consecutive runs fail. When escalating, include logs from the matrix job and quote the trace token printed below.

pipeline stamp: htk9_ce63042d9

## QueueTide Environments

QueueTide is the autoscaler that sizes worker pools from queue depth. We maintain three environments: dev (synthetic queues, scaling decisions logged but not applied), staging (real queues, capped replica counts), and prod. When reviewing scaling-policy changes, please verify behaviour in staging, since thresholds there intentionally match prod while caps protect the cluster. Each environment loads its configuration at startup; the staging values are reproduced below for reference.

config for badup-kagap:
OLIOX_PIN=5344
OLIOX_METRICS_HOST=metrics.oliox.zemvarcorp.corp
OLIOX_LOG_LEVEL=error
OLIOX_TENANT=pelox